The most prevalent attachment style among u.s. infants is the _____ attachment style.

The most prevalent attachment style among u.s. infants is the <u>secure</u> attachment style.

Attachment styles theory outlines how your bond with your primary caregivers sets the foundation for the way you navigate relationships during life. Attachment styles or types are characterized by using the behavior exhibited within a relationship, especially when that relationship is threatened. Consistent with the idea, there are 4 types of attachment styles:

  • Secure
  • Avoidant (aka dismissive, or anxious-avoidant in kids)
  • Anxious (aka preoccupied, or anxious-ambivalent in children)
  • Disorganized (aka frightened-avoidant in kids)

The secure attachment style is the most common type of attachment in western society. research suggests that around 66% of the US population is securely connected. Humans who've developed this kind of attachment are self-contented, social, warm, and easy to connect to.
